Card Rarity and Value

Card rarity and value are essential factors that can greatly influence your overall collection and its potential worth. Rarity levels like common, uncommon, rare, and ultra-rare directly impact a card’s desirability and market price. Limited-edition or special foil cards tend to fetch higher prices due to their scarcity and collectibility. Unique or hard-to-find cards can considerably boost the overall value of your collection or set. Rarity is usually indicated by symbols, holographic features, or numbering, helping collectors easily identify rare cards. Keep in mind, a card’s value isn’t solely determined by rarity; condition, demand, and how it fits into gameplay or set completion also play important roles. Balancing these factors helps you make smarter choices when building your collection.

Storage and Organization Needs

Organizing and storing your collectible trading cards is just as important as selecting the right game for your skill level and interests. Proper storage solutions, like sturdy card boxes or cases, can hold hundreds or even thousands of cards, protecting them from damage. Dividers and sleeves help categorize cards by set, rarity, or type, making it easier to find what you need quickly during gameplay or trading. Modular storage systems, such as stackable boxes or customizable organizers, allow your collection to grow without chaos. Labeled compartments or adjustable dividers keep different games or series separated, reducing confusion. Using durable, protective materials like laminated or hard plastic cases ensures your cards stay in pristine condition over time, safeguarding against wear, dust, and environmental damage.

Price and Accessibility

The cost and availability of trading card games play a crucial role in deciding which one to pursue. Starter decks typically range from $10 to $30, making them accessible for most new players. Booster packs usually cost between $3 and $10 each, so building a collection can add up quickly. Accessibility depends on where you shop—local stores or online retailers—affecting how easily you can find specific cards or new releases. Digital versions are often more affordable and offer easier access, sometimes with exclusive digital-only cards. Limited edition or rare packs can sell out fast or be hard to find, impacting your ability to complete sets or build competitive decks. Overall, affordability and ease of access are key factors shaping your trading card game experience.
